Architectural Elements Resolved Through Bespoke Joinery

Bespoke joinery can play a structural role within an interior design project. Rather than simply furnishing a room, it organizes circulation, defines functions, and transforms the perception of proportions. This capability turns bespoke furniture design into an architectural tool.

Decorative Wall Panels and Premium Wood Cladding

Wood paneling transforms a wall into a continuous surface capable of concealing doors, installations, or storage spaces. The choice of timber, panel layout, and grain direction determines the overall visual rhythm.

In bespoke interior design projects, these claddings also provide warmth and depth. They can extend seamlessly between different rooms, wrap around a central volume, or create a smooth transition between materials. Every junction is carefully designed so that sockets, switches, lighting, and opening systems are integrated with precision.

Integrated Furniture: Wardrobes, Dressing Rooms, and Hidden Bookcases

Flush-fitted wardrobes, bookcases with concealed doors, and dressing rooms configured according to the user’s daily routines make it possible to maximize every centimetre without overwhelming the space. Customization extends to both the exterior and the internal organization: shelves, drawers, lighting, hanging rails, and accessories are designed to meet real needs.

Before designing a bespoke wardrobe, it is important to analyse what will be stored, how frequently each item will be used, and how much space each element requires. The same principle applies to open dressing room designs, where the interior organization remains visible and becomes part of the overall aesthetic.

The Coblonal "Box" Concept: Multifunctional Wooden Modules

In several Coblonal projects, wood is used to create a central “box” that brings together multiple functions. This volume can incorporate the kitchen, storage areas, a bathroom, building services, or transitions between rooms. Its presence organizes the floor plan and reduces the need for conventional partitions.

The box functions as a piece of bespoke joinery on an architectural scale. Each façade responds to a different function, while the overall composition maintains a clean and cohesive appearance. Premium and Certified Woods: A Commitment to Excellence and Timelessness

The quality of the wood influences the appearance, feel, and evolution of each piece. Oak, walnut, ash, and rosewood each offer distinct grain patterns, tones, and densities. The selection depends on the intended use, the lighting, and the material language of the project.

Bespoke joinery also requires careful consideration of the origin of the raw materials. Using certified timber and working with responsible suppliers makes it possible to combine outstanding craftsmanship with environmental commitment. A well-crafted piece can last for decades, be repaired, and adapt to new uses over time.

Integrated Design and Execution: Guaranteeing Perfection in Every Architectural Detail

The final quality of a project depends on the continuity between design, manufacturing, and installation. A bespoke joinery project requires precise measurements, detailed technical drawings, finish samples, and careful coordination with electrical, HVAC, lighting, and construction teams.

Bespoke furniture solutions are defined from the earliest stages to avoid improvisation. This ensures that every piece integrates seamlessly with the architecture while maintaining the coherence of the overall project.
